Pauline E. Fitch

August 17, 1925 — July 13, 2011

A graveside service for Pauline E. Fitch, 85, of Circle Pines, MN, formerly of Granville, will be held at 11:00 a.m. Monday, August 1, 2011 at Maple Grove Cemetery in Granville with Pastor Bob Long officiating. Pauline died Wednesday, July 13, 2011 at Unity Hospital in Minneapolis. She was born in Granville to the late Clyde E. and Bertha E. (Johnson) Sunkle.

Pauline was a devoted wife and mother. She traveled extensively in Germany and abroad with her husband, Ernest, a Vietnam veteran, who retired after 28 years of service in the U.S. Army. Pauline was a member of Centenary United Methodist Church since 1934. She also attended Jonesboro (GA) First Baptist Church from 1978 to 1993 and was a member of TWIG 6 of Licking County. She enjoyed knitting, reading, amateur photography, and enjoyed writing letters.

Surviving are her sons and daughters-in-law, Bob and Taffie Fitch of Newark, and Mike and Maggie Fitch of Reynoldsburg; daughters and son-in-law, Shirley Hovik of Circle Pines, MN, and Molly and Kenny Campbell of Winston, GA; seven grandchildren; and seven great-grandchildren.

In addition to her parents, she is preceded in death by her husband, Ernest, who died December 17, 1993; and brother, Harold Sunkle.
